What is a Divan bed?

Only the most popular bed base in Britain! Seriously. This speaks volumes for the quality of sleep they provide. 

Sold without a mattress or a headboard, and ideal for those of you who already have both.

Divan bed bases are upholstered wooden boxes, built to last from sturdy, responsibly sourced timber. Unlike standard bed frames or bases which provide one solid base for your mattress, Divans come in two sections, sometimes more, which seamlessly sit side-by-side on your bedroom floor. It makes them the lightest and easiest to move bed base on the market.

You can choose built-in storage beneath the mattress, from Ottomans, to drawers on all four sides. Up top, you can opt for extra-soft cushioning springs or firmer padding, both designed to enhance the feel of your mattress.

Upholstered with your choice of fabric, divans are incredibly flexible and customisable.

Will I need to assemble a divan?

There is some assembly required, but it is minimal. Usually, divan beds come in two main parts with easy-to-follow instructions that will guide you through the process. When you’ve connected the divans together (and added a divan headboard if you’re having one), it’s ready to go.

So what different types are there?

As is with a specially chosen mattress, which is only as good as the bed base below it, divans are designed to cater to your specific sleep preferences. Here at Bed Guru, we have three main types.

1. Sprung Top Divan 

These solid timber frames of ours are finished with a shallow layer of open coil or pocket springs, which run the entire length of your bed, from edge to edge. How deep said layer is, is up to you. It's a toss-up between two depths. Three for our antique bed bases. 

Sprung top divan beds, with what is essentially a second thin mattress, increase the lifespan or your pocket sprung mattress. Ultimately, they are designed to soften the feel of your mattress. 

2. Platform / Firm Top Divan 

Swap your springs for a layer of padding, and you have yourself a divan bed base which offers a firmer, but no less comfortable sleep. It's the better choice for those among you with a firmer feel mattress made without springs. Perhaps latex or memory foam? 

3. Electrical Adjustable Bases

This isn't a fixed top, so it requires something altogether different. Our electrical divan beds are topped with adjustable solid beech slats which move and hold you comfortably in your ideal position at the push of a button. All of which is powered by a motorised mechanism.

Electrical adjustable divans very literally help you out of bed in the morning! And there's still plenty of storage space underneath.

Any more for any more?

Whether you own an Edwardian bed frame, something of roughly the same vintage, or simply want to be the host with the most, hold onto your hats. There's a specially designed, British-made Divan for you as well.

1. Divan Bed Base for Antique Frames

Breathe a sigh of relief, for you have finally found the ideal divan bed base, expertly made-to-measure for your awkward-sized antique bed frame. We have the short, narrow and non-standard shapes down to a T.

Their tapered corners fit snug over your original bolts, to prevent damage to the frame and sagging to your mattress. While the solid timber frame, with either a sprung or firm surface, can reach your perfect height. 

2.  Zip & Link Divan Beds

Hoteliers and guest bedroom owners these are aimed at you. Zip & Link divans are two separate beds which seamlessly join to make one King or Super King size bed, and vice versa. While the Zip & Link mattresses often steal the show, they'd be nothing without their firm top counterparts, neatly connected below.

How big are divan beds?

It depends on which type of divan you’re after. Firm Top Divans are available in 21 standard and non-standard UK and EU sizes, while there are 12 antique bed base styles. Sprung Top Divans range from a small single to a king size.

How to find a headboard for your divan bed

Unlike bedsteads, divan beds are traditionally sold without a headboard – although they are easily fitted with headboard bolts.

Simply check how much space you have above your bed. Decide whether you’ll lean against your headboard (for example, if you regularly read or watch TV in bed) or use it purely for decoration. Then check out these triple panelled, stylish rectangular headboards. You can upholster them to match your bed base seamlessly, for a more uniform look.

Do I need a divan wrap?

Covering your divan bed base in a wrap really can transform the look of your bed; it’s a simple yet effective way to add some style. A divan wrap usually comes in one piece, complete with elastic at the top and bottom to make it easy to fit and ensure it stays firmly in place. All kinds of different materials are available to suit your tastes (including suede), so you can create a design that suits your style.
